Portland Trail Blazers' Trade for Ja Morant Could Complicate Future for Israeli Forward Deni Avdija

Deni Avdija enters the upcoming NBA season following the best year of his career, but a major trade that brought All-Star Ja Morant to the Portland Trail Blazers may complicate his future with the team. CBS Sports analyzed the trade, which sent Jeremy Grant and Chris Murray to Memphis in exchange for Morant, noting that while it upgrades Portland’s roster, it could create financial challenges for retaining Avdija long-term.

According to analyst Sam Quinn, Portland took on significant long-term salary commitments with Morant’s contract, which may hinder negotiations to extend Avdija’s contract in 2027. Quinn described the trade as understandable but potentially disadvantageous for the Blazers, as the financial burden could limit their flexibility.

Avdija, the ninth overall pick in the 2020 NBA Draft, is entering the third year of his four-year, $55 million contract, earning about $13 million this season and $11 million next year, figures considered modest for a player of his caliber. Morant, by contrast, is set to earn approximately $42 million this season and $44 million in 2027-28. Donovan Klingen’s contract also expires around the same time, adding to Portland’s impending salary cap decisions.

The Blazers have roughly two years to decide their core roster moving forward. While Avdija’s recent performance suggests he could be a foundational player, Morant’s arrival complicates the picture. Portland will likely face tough choices on which players to retain, as they cannot keep everyone under contract simultaneously.
